PM Nawaz return: PIA Boeing 777 will fly to London tonight

Preparations for the prime minister’s return to Pakistan are underway and he is expected to return home on Saturday.

PIA’s Boeing-777 aircraft will fly to London tonight to take back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if and his entourage.

The engineers of the national airliner have been instructed to transform two Boeing-777 aircrafts into VIP jets. One of the two jets will be kept as standby. According to sources, the regular seats of the airliner have been removed and 24 VIP seats have been installed in the aircraft for Sharif and his co-travellers.

Sources said that the PIA administration has been instructed to prepare VIP meals for the prime minister as well.

The airliner will fly to London on Friday night and will land at Stansted Airport on Saturday
at 6:00 a.m. according to the local time. The airliner will start its return journey to Lahore at 8:00 a.m.

The doctors have allowed PM Nawaz to travel by air.

Nawaz Sharif, on 22nd May, had left for the United Kingdom and underwent a successful open heart surgery on 31st May.

The national airlines will bear millions of dollars fuel expenses for the prime minister’s home return. PIA flights will also disturbed badly due to setting aside two Boeing aircrafts off the schedule for the prime minister’s travel from London to Lahore.
